Maria Rosvall is a Professor and Chief Physician at the University of Gothenburg. Her research primarily focuses on socio-geographical disparities, cardiometabolic multimorbidity, and cause-specific mortality through various population-based cohort studies in Sweden. Rosvall has contributed significantly to understanding the intersections of mental health, physical health, and socio-demographics. With numerous publications in high-impact journals such as the Journal of Public Health and Preventive Medicine Reports, her work explores the health locus of control, psychological well-being, and the effects of social capital on health outcomes. She has led research that investigates the impact of significant life events on population health, with a keen interest in marginalized communities and how various factors contribute to health inequalities. By employing rigorous statistical methodologies and intersectional analyses, she strives to inform public health policies and healthcare practices, aiming to reduce health disparities and improve overall health outcomes for diverse populations.
